Ukraine plans to establish a distinct military division focused on drone operations

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elsnky announced the creation of a separate department focused on drones drones

Drones - the key at this war

According to reports, the Unmanned Systems Force will focus its efforts in particular on improving Ukraine's drone work, creating special units specializing in drones, intensifying training, systematizing their use, increasing production and promoting innovation.

Zelensky in a statement on Tuesday, commented on the situation on the frontline and announced an intensification of drone operations. - This year should be decisive in many aspects – and, obviously, on the battlefield (...) Drones – unmanned systems – have proven their effectiveness in battles on land, in the sky, and at sea (...) Ukraine has really changed the security situation in the Black Sea thanks to drones. Repelling assaults on the ground is largely the work of drones. The large-scale destruction of the (Russian) occupiers and their equipment is (also due to) drones - he said.

As reported "The Kyiv Independnet" according to the President's Office, the division will be aimed at "enhancing the capabilities of the Ukrainian armed forces and the use of unmanned and robotic air, sea and ground systems."

During the Russia-Ukraine conflict, battles involving drones frequently feature large numbers of drones launching simultaneous attacks. For instance, a Russian offensive in November utilized a swarm of 75 drones manufactured in Iran - as reported by Ukraine's air force.
